S3 Object Storage is a type of cloud storage designed to store and manage vast amounts of unstructured data, such as photos, videos, backups, and log files. Unlike traditional file systems, S3 Object Storage uses a flat structure where each piece of data is stored as an object, identified by a unique key. This allows for more flexible and scalable storage solutions, making it ideal for the modern digital era.

Best Practices for Optimizing S3 Object Storage

Implement Lifecycle Policies

To optimize the use of S3 Object Storage, it's essential to implement lifecycle policies. These policies automate the transition of objects to different storage classes based on their age and usage patterns. For example, you can move infrequently accessed data to a lower-cost storage class, reducing your overall storage costs while maintaining accessibility when needed.

Use Versioning

Versioning is a powerful feature of S3 Object Storage that allows you to keep multiple versions of an object. This is particularly useful for protecting against accidental deletions or overwrites. By enabling versioning, you can easily restore previous versions of an object, ensuring that your data is always safe and recoverable.

Comparisons with Other Storage Solutions

File Storage

File storage systems, such as Network Attached Storage (NAS), are designed to store and manage data in a hierarchical file structure. While file storage is suitable for certain use cases, it lacks the scalability and flexibility of S3 Object Storage. Additionally, file storage systems can become cumbersome to manage as data volumes grow, making S3 Object Storage a more efficient solution for large-scale data management.

Block Storage

Block storage, commonly used in Storage Area Networks (SANs), stores data in fixed-size blocks. While block storage offers high performance and is often used for databases and virtual machines, it is less suited for storing unstructured data. S3 Object Storage, with its flat structure and scalability, is better equipped to handle large volumes of diverse data types.
